Arsenal will have to pay big money if they're to offload Mesut Ozil to MLS.

The Daily Express says DC United are reported to be interested in Ozil replacing the outgoing Wayne Rooney, who is joining Derby County in January.

He is believed to be the Premier League's second-highest earner behind Manchester United flop and former Arsenal player Alexis Sanchez, on wages of 350,000 per week.

But salaries in Major League Soccer are nowhere near those paid by Premier League clubs, with the league's top earner Zlatan Ibrahimovic on 115,000 per week.

So the Germany midfielder would have to take a pay cut if DC United can be persuaded to take him on when his representatives fly to Washington this week.

One option is that Arsenal could part-fund any deal.
